summaryrefslogtreecommitdiff
path: root/src/location/maps/qgeomappingmanager.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/location/maps/qgeomappingmanager.h')
-rw-r--r--src/location/maps/qgeomappingmanager.h3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/location/maps/qgeomappingmanager.h b/src/location/maps/qgeomappingmanager.h
index fe6f74b3..aa877985 100644
--- a/src/location/maps/qgeomappingmanager.h
+++ b/src/location/maps/qgeomappingmanager.h
@@ -45,6 +45,7 @@
#include <QObject>
#include <QSize>
#include <QPair>
+#include <QSharedPointer>
#include <QtLocation/qlocationglobal.h>
#include "qgeomaptype.h"
@@ -113,7 +114,7 @@ Q_SIGNALS:
private:
QGeoMappingManager(QGeoMappingManagerEngine *engine, QObject *parent = 0);
- QGeoMappingManagerPrivate* d_ptr;
+ QSharedPointer<QGeoMappingManagerPrivate> d_ptr;
Q_DISABLE_COPY(QGeoMappingManager)
friend class QGeoServiceProvider;